Description

Learn everything there is to know about the amazing human body with this fact-filled encyclopedia. Did you know that every part in your human body is made of tiny, microscopic cells?

Did you know your body is organized into distinct systems that have different functions?

Learn more about this and much more with the First Human Body Encyclopedia. Know what is inside your bones, find out about how joints move and how muscles work.

Peek into the control centre of the body - the brain.

Explore all the senses including touch, sight, hearing, smell, and taste.

Find out how our organs, such as heart and lungs, work. You will also see how your body changes as you grow older and hormones develop.

Discover how your body fights against germs and allergies and explore how we express and communicate.

Then test yourself - and your friends and family - with the quiz pages in the end. First Human Body Encyclopedia is the perfect home resource for young children to start learning all about how our bodies work.
